gully

  • Gully
  • n.

    A grooved iron rail or tram plate.

  • Gully
  • n.

    A channel or hollow worn in the earth by a current of water; a short deep portion of a torrent's bed when dry.

  • Gulch
  • n.

    A ravine, or part of the deep bed of a torrent when dry; a gully.

  • Gullying
  • p. pr. & vb. n.

    of Gully

  • Gullies
  • pl.

    of Gully

  • Gully
  • n.

    A large knife.

  • Couloir
  • n.

    A deep gorge; a gully.

  • Gullied
  • imp. & p. p.

    of Gully

  • Gully
  • v. i.

    To flow noisily.

  • Gully
  • v. t.

    To wear into a gully or into gullies.
